Denitrification and Oxygen Cycling in Saanich Inlet

A poster presentation at the Fall AGU meeting in San Francisco in December 2008 was made describing recent water column measurements in Saanich Inlet, including observations from the VENUS network. Summarized below in some of the poster sections are evidence for deep water renewal, tied to periods of weak neap tides, and Oxygen and Nitrogen cycling. Conclusions highlight that four distinct renewal events were captured in the fall of 2008, biogenic N2 was isotopically heavy, and the upward flux of N2 due to internal mixing requires a denitrification rate of 30 nmol/kg/day.
